The best robot vacuums have powerful suction that is able to remove dirt and debris from a wide range of flooring types. This information is available in the manufacturer's specifications, which are usually expressed in Pascals (Pa). Higher Pa values indicate more power. It is a good idea to choose a robot vacuum with at least 2000 Pa, as this is sufficient for most homes. A robot vacuum that can be used as a mop is one of the most useful features. Make sure to cover any mirrors you have purchased robot cleaners prior to when the device is able to map your home for the very first time. This is due to the fact that the LIDAR sensors that robo-vacs use to navigate can bounce off of reflective surfaces, which causes the machine to “perceive” the mirror as a potential obstacle. Robots can also be in danger of being slowed by dark colored objects, such as chairs and toys for children. This happens because the cliff sensors on robots are sensitive to infrared radiation which is absorbed by surfaces with darker colors. Most robot vacuums are available in square and round designs with round models able to maneuver around furniture legs better, while not as effective at reaching corners. Square models, on the other hand are more angular design and can reach into corners more easily. They require a larger space to navigate and are prone to run into other objects. Robot vacuums are great for midweek routine cleaning and regular touch-ups, but they're not able to replace an upright or canister on thick carpets or hard flooring. They can still be tangled with rugs, and aren't able to clean up certain particles, and miss spots of dirt on hard flooring. It's essential to sweep your entire home prior to using a robotic and to make sure all cords to power, clothing fringes on the rug, window blind cords are kept away from the device's sensors and charging contacts.
